COMPARSION STUDIES ON TRANSDERMAL FILMS OF NATURAL TAMARIND SEED POLYSACCHARIDE EXTRACT CONTAINING ANTI HYPERTENSION DRUG WITH PVA ,HPMC AND GUAR GUM.

M.SantoshNaidu, G.V.Radha, P.Girish1and D.Lohithasu*

Abstract

Objective of the study: The present study was to compare the transdermal film property of the natural Tamarind seed polysaccharide extract with the synthetic and natural polymers like PVA, HPMC and Guar gum. The transdermal films prepared by solvent casting method using Tamarind seed polysaccharide (TSP) alone and combinations with other polymers and film properties are evaluated. The release property of various film forming agent in increasing order are TSP>PVA>guar gum>HPMC. Conclusion: Tamarind seed polysaccharide (TSP) combination has showed the drug retardant property. The order of drug release for different formulation is given as follows F2>F1>F8>F7>F14>F11>F6>F5>F4>F3>F13>F12>F9>F10. Formulated Transdermal Films evaluated for various physicochemical parameters and in vitro permeation studies. Transdermal drug delivery system (TDDS) facilitates delivery of therapeutically effective amount of drug across a patient’s skin with controlled rate.

Keywords: Tamarind seed polysaccharide (TSP), Retardant property, PVA, HPMC and Guar gum.
